Pak-US to ink science, technology cooperation accord extension
WASHINGTON: Pakistan and the US have agreed to the extension of an accord relating to cooperation in science and technology for another five years,
Secretary Foreign Affairs Jalil Abbas Jilani on behalf of Pakistan and the US Assistant Secretary of State for Oceans and International Environmental and Scientific Affairs, Dr. Kerri-Ann Jones will ink the accord, which would be paving way for stepping up the cooperation in technology and engineering between the two countries.
